Easy Homemade Vegetable Broth

Author: Traffic Light Cook
A no-sodium flavorful broth to bring smile to your soups and more! 
Vegan, gluten-free, soy-free
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 50 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 5 minutes
Servings 10 Cups
Calories 26 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1 medium onion diced, (1cup)
  • 2-3 cloves garlic minced
  • 1 leek (only the (white and light green part)
  • 2 small carrots diced, (1 cup)
  • 1-2 ribs celery diced (1 cup)
  • 4 oz cremini mushroom (1cup) (or any other type)
  • 5-7 stems parsley (without leaves)
  • 2-3 sprigs fresh thyme (1/2 tsp, if using dried)
  • 1 bayleaf
  • 4-6 black peppercorns cracked
  • 1 tsp fennel seeds*
  • 1/8 tsp crushed red pepper (optional)
  • 1/2 tsp avocado oil
  • 10 cups cold water

Instructions
 

  • Heat the oil** on medium heat in a stockpot. Add onions and garlic; sweat***  for 1 minute.
  • Add mushrooms, sweat for another minute. Add celery, carrots, and any other vegetable (if using), except tomato. Sweat for 4-6 minutes. Add tomatoes (if using). Add bayleaf, fennel seeds, and peppercorns. 
  • Add the cold water and bring to a gentle simmer (about 20 minutes). Reduce the heat to medium-low and simmer gently for another 20-30 minutes. 
  • Remove from heat and filter the broth through a fine-mesh sieve into a broad mouth pan for quick cooling. Once the broth is completely cooled, funnel it into bottles. You can use this now in countless recipes! 

Notes

*if using fresh fennel, don't use fennel seeds
**Fat-free variation: Skip sweating the veggies in oil. Add 10 cups of water to the diced vegetables and bring to a gentle simmer. Reduce the heat to medium-low and simmer for another 45 minutes. This version may have a bit raw, pungent taste to it, but not a huge deal as you would not be able to detect it in the end dish. 
***Sweating is a cooking technique where vegetables are cooked over medium heat in a little bit of oil without browning. When vegetables are soft around the edges and begin to show beads of sweat, move onto the next step.
